The Peanut Oil Market was valued at USD 2.39 billion in 2025 and is projected to grow to USD 2.54 billion in 2026, with a CAGR of 6.75%, reaching USD 3.77 billion by 2032.

KEY MARKET STATISTICS
Base Year [2025] USD 2.39 billion
Estimated Year [2026] USD 2.54 billion
Forecast Year [2032] USD 3.77 billion
CAGR (%) 6.75%

An incisive introduction that frames peanut oil's culinary and industrial relevance, supply chain characteristics, and evolving consumer and regulatory priorities

Peanut oil occupies a distinct position at the intersection of traditional culinary use and expanding industrial applications. Historically prized for its high smoke point and neutral flavor profile, the oil remains widely used across culinary practices such as cooking, frying, and salad dressings, while its fatty acid composition and stability have attracted interest from cosmetics and pharmaceutical formulators. Recent years have seen an intensification of consumer interest in product provenance, extraction methods, and claims related to organic production and cold-press processing, which together are reshaping purchasing criteria across commercial and residential end users.

The supply chain for peanut oil is influenced by agricultural cycles, varietal selection, and the geographic concentration of peanut cultivation. Processing choices, notably between cold-pressed and refined extraction, create divergent quality attributes and cost structures that inform route-to-market decisions and packaging formats such as bottles, drums, pouches, and tins. Distribution pathways range from convenience stores and supermarkets to direct-to-consumer online platforms, each channel demanding tailored packaging, labeling, and pricing strategies. Regulatory frameworks and food safety standards further modulate product formulations and cross-border trade. Consequently, stakeholders must balance sensory quality, functional performance, regulatory compliance, and brand positioning to compete effectively in an increasingly segmented market landscape.

A strategic account of the major structural shifts reshaping peanut oil markets including consumer preferences, processing technologies, and supply chain reconfiguration

The peanut oil landscape is undergoing transformative shifts driven by evolving consumer preferences, technological advances in processing, and the strategic reconfiguration of global supply chains. Health- and wellness-driven demand has elevated interest in extraction modalities; cold-pressed variants are being positioned as premium, minimally processed alternatives while refined oils continue to serve high-temperature cooking needs. Parallel to this, sustainability considerations have prompted greater scrutiny of sourcing practices, crop rotation impacts, and waste reduction in oil milling and packaging.

Technological improvements in refining, degumming, and deodorization have improved oxidative stability and broadened application scope, enabling peanut oil to penetrate additional industrial segments such as specialty cosmetics and pharmaceutical excipients. Digital commerce and omnichannel retailing have accelerated direct relationships between brands and end users, creating opportunities for traceability storytelling and subscription models. Meanwhile, private-label entrants and agile niche brands are compressing time-to-market for differentiated offerings. As a result, producers and distributors are investing in flexible production processes, adaptive packaging solutions, and enhanced quality assurance to maintain competitive differentiation and to respond quickly to shifts in demand and regulatory changes.

A focused analysis of the 2025 tariff shifts that reconfigured trade routes, sourcing decisions, and procurement resilience strategies across the peanut oil value chain

Tariff adjustments introduced in 2025 have introduced a new layer of complexity into international peanut oil flows and procurement strategies. Trade policy changes have altered the relative economics of cross-border sourcing, prompting buyers and processors to reassess supplier networks and inventory policies. In response, many commercial buyers have evaluated nearshoring options and diversified supplier bases to reduce exposure to tariff-induced cost volatility. Procurement teams have increasingly prioritized flexible contract terms, shorter lead times, and buffer inventories to manage the unpredictability of trade barriers.

The tariff environment has also accelerated value-chain optimization, where manufacturers focus on cost-to-serve reductions through localized packaging, consolidation of logistics lanes, and adjustments to extraction and refining sequences that reduce the impact of duties on finished-product margins. Smaller processors and specialty brands have faced disproportionate pressure, driving strategic partnerships, co-packing arrangements, and vertical integration initiatives to preserve competitiveness. On the demand side, higher landed costs in some sourcing scenarios have led end users to consider formulation adjustments and alternative oils; however, where functional and sensory properties of peanut oil are indispensable, buyers have chosen to absorb incremental costs or pursue premium positioning rather than substitute outright. Overall, tariff effects have catalyzed structural realignments across procurement, channel strategy, and product positioning.

Integrated segmentation insights across application, extraction, product type, end user, distribution channel, and packaging type that inform portfolio and channel strategies

Segmentation insights reveal differentiated performance and strategic priorities across application categories, extraction methods, product types, end users, distribution channels, and packaging formats. Within application, culinary uses such as cooking, frying, and salad dressing continue to dominate demand patterns, driven by functional requirements for high smoke point and neutral flavor; concurrently, industrial uses in cosmetics and pharmaceuticals are expanding due to interest in emollient properties and stable carrier oils. Extraction process segmentation distinguishes cold-pressed offerings, which command attention for perceived nutritional and sensory benefits, from refined variants that meet volume, stability, and cost imperatives for large-scale frying operations and industrial formulations.

Product type segmentation highlights divergent positioning between conventional oils and organic-certified alternatives where clean-label and provenance narratives are most valuable. End user segmentation underscores distinct value propositions for commercial customers who prioritize consistent performance and supply reliability, versus residential buyers who focus on health claims, packaging convenience, and price sensitivity. Distribution channel segmentation differentiates impulse and convenience purchases through convenience stores, broad-reach penetration via supermarkets and hypermarkets, and targeted, personalized engagement through online stores that enable direct-to-consumer storytelling and subscription fulfillment. Packaging type segmentation reveals trade-offs among bottles that suit retail and household use, drums for bulk industrial buyers, pouches that optimize shelf space and cost-efficiency, and tins that align with premium positioning and extended shelf stability. Together, these segmentation lenses inform portfolio strategies, pricing architecture, and route-to-market optimization for manufacturers and distributors seeking to align product attributes with channel and user expectations.

A nuanced exploration of regional dynamics that explains how production, regulation, retail structures, and consumer preferences differ across major global territories

Regional dynamics shape competitive advantages and risk profiles across the Americas, Europe, Middle East & Africa, and Asia-Pacific markets. In the Americas, established processing infrastructure, proximity to major peanut-producing regions, and integrated logistics networks support a mix of both commodity and value-added peanut oil production, enabling responsiveness to commercial frying demand and foodservice customers. The region also displays strong private-label activity and growing interest in organic and cold-pressed variants driven by consumer health trends. In Europe, Middle East & Africa, regulatory stringency, labeling requirements, and consumer scrutiny around allergen management and traceability create both compliance burdens and opportunities for premiumization and certified product claims. Manufacturers in this region are investing in provenance programs and supply chain transparency to meet retailer and regulator expectations.

Asia-Pacific reflects heterogenous market dynamics where dense population centers drive high-volume culinary use and regional cuisine preferences influence formulation and packaging choices. Rapid modernization of retail and expanding e-commerce penetration are enabling niche brands to scale, while industrial demand in cosmetics and pharmaceuticals remains a key growth vector. Across all regions, logistical resilience, regulatory adaptability, and alignment with local culinary and industrial specifications determine market entry success. Consequently, firms are prioritizing regionalized manufacturing, flexible packaging strategies, and localized marketing that resonates with cultural preferences and distribution infrastructure.

A comprehensive assessment of competitive strategies and capabilities among processors, specialty producers, and brand owners that determines market positioning and growth levers

The competitive landscape is characterized by a mix of legacy processors, regional refiners, specialty cold-press producers, and agile brand owners that combine manufacturing capabilities with marketing sophistication. Leading operators differentiate through integrated sourcing models, investments in processing flexibility that accommodate both cold-pressed and refined output, and partnerships that secure access to certified organic and sustainably farmed peanuts. Many companies are emphasizing traceability systems, quality assurance programs, and third-party certifications to reinforce food-safety credentials and to support premium pricing where product provenance matters.

At the same time, smaller niche producers and start-ups are leveraging direct-to-consumer channels, social media storytelling, and product innovation-such as flavored or fortified peanut oil blends-to capture health- and taste-driven segments. Co-packers and specialty packagers have become strategic allies for expanding brands that need to scale quickly without incurring heavy capital outlays. In addition, contract manufacturing arrangements and toll refining are increasingly common as brands seek to balance control over formulations with cost flexibility. Overall, competitive advantage is being shaped by the ability to synchronize sourcing resilience, processing versatility, and differentiated go-to-market capabilities while managing compliance and trade complexities.
